Hi all,
This year I will be working on a full performance of Claude Bolling's Toot Suite, but performed by 6 trumpets so that the work can be performed in full.

It is my understanding that the piece is impossible to play all the way through as one player due to endurance issues.

Have you or anyone you know performed the whole thing? Have you seen it performed? What are you experiences with this piece?

I believe there may be a thread on this very issue, if you do a quick Google.

It's rare, but it's been done successfully. I recall a colleague from my undergrad days at the New England Conservatory who performed the whole work on a recital - including other works: (virtually) anything's possible if you have the right set-up, put in the right practice regimen, and set your mind to it!

I performed the full toot suite live (plus a couple of other pieces) a few years back as part of a 4 performance "tour" of churches in the Philly Suburbs.

Difficult, but doable...

Actually chronicled it "as it was happening" in an older thread here on TH asking the very same question...

https://www.trumpetherald.com/forum/viewtopic.php?t=139350

Went on to do a studio recording after the tour.
